The first sound in an Indian household is rarely an alarm clock. It is the muffled sound of a pressure cooker whistling in the kitchen, the clink of steel tumblers being arranged on a tray, and the distant, sleepy muttering of a grandmother reciting a morning prayer. To an outsider, the Indian family lifestyle might appear as a controlled explosion of noise, color, and movement. But to those living it, it is a deeply structured, ancient rhythm—a dance of duty, affection, and resilience that has survived technology, globalization, and the relentless march of modernity.

Consider the story of the Sharma family in Jaipur. Grandfather (Dada ji) is doing his surya namaskar on the terrace, muttering mantras. Bhabhi (eldest daughter-in-law, Priya) is packing three tiffin boxes: one for her husband (low-carb), one for her son (junk food hidden under roti), and one for her father-in-law (low-salt). Her mother-in-law is yelling from the kitchen about the missing hing (asafoetida).

When a mother falls sick, she does not hire a nanny. The younger sister-in-law takes over the cooking. The neighbor brings over upma (a savory breakfast dish). The grandfather picks the kids up from school.

Storytime: Meera, the mother, uses the 45-minute metro ride as her "me time." In a culture that prioritizes the group over the individual, those 45 minutes are sacred. She listens to a spiritual podcast while the train sways past the concrete flyovers. This duality—squeezing personal space out of public chaos—is a quintessential modern Indian story. In the daily life stories of an Indian family, no one suffers alone. When the eldest son lost his job during the pandemic, the family didn't cut expenses by firing the cook; they simply told him, "We are in this together." The father extended his retirement. The mother started a small pickle business. The sister shared her salary. Within six months, the son was back on his feet, and the family was actually closer than before.
